Team, this note briefs our incoming director on the planned price increase for legacy Corvessa Suite customers. Roughly 1,400 accounts remain on pre-2019 terms, in many cases 30% below current list. The proposal applies a staged uplift over two renewal cycles, with caps for the smallest accounts. Churn modelling by the Ravensmoor team suggests acceptable attrition. Customer communications are drafted and await sign-off. Legal has cleared the contract language. The broader commercial intent behind this move is summarised below.

confidential, kagup-bafog: Fraaxax Group is in early talks to buy Soroxox Group for about $343.8 million. The Olidor launch date is June 14, and nothing goes to the press before then. Legal wants the Aldmirek Logistics term sheet signed before July 23.

CI note for on-call: the relevance-tuning job on the Marwick search cluster fails when the synonym dictionary is regenerated mid-run. Restarting the tuner after the dictionary job completes clears it. Do not re-rank manually; the Oakfell harness will re-score automatically on the next pass. The failing run is identified by the token below.

build token for kagaf-hahof: htk14_9d3d4d26d7d8de

Handover note — Crumbwheel order cutoffs.

Welcome aboard. The bakery cutoff rule in Crumbwheel closes same-day orders at 14:00 local to each storefront, not UTC — this has bitten us twice. Holiday overrides live in the calendar service and take precedence silently, so always check there first when a cutoff looks wrong. To unlock the calendar service's admin console after a restart, enter the recovery passphrase below.

vault phrase of bagap-bahaf = silion-pelox-sorox-casdor-quenwyn-fraax-eliox-praael-kelion-quenvan-kasox-rusael-norius-belvan